Answer to Question 1

ANS: D
Cardiac fibers are separated by irregular transverse thickenings of the sarcolemma called interca-lated discs. These discs provide structural support and aid in electrical conduction between fi-bers.

Answer to Question 2

ANS: D
In combination, the branches of the left coronary artery normally supply most of the left ventri-cle, the left atrium, and the anterior two-thirds of the interventricular septum.

Though Candida and Aspergillus species are the most common fungal pathogens causing invasive fungal disease in the immunocompromised, infections due to previously uncommon hyaline and dematiaceous filamentous fungi are occurring more often today. Rare fungal infections, once accurately diagnosed, may require surgical debridement, immunotherapy, and newer antifungals used singly or in combination with older antifungals, on a case-by-case basis.
